Job Summary

Overview

We are seeking an experienced solicitor to join our team as a specialist in Financial Services Regulation.

The candidate must have a deep understanding of the Financial Services and Markets Act 2000 (FSMA) the PRA Rulebook FCA Handbook the Regulated Activities Order the Financial Promotions Order MiFID and consumer credit and mortgage regulation etc.

Responsibilities

The role involves advising clients on legal regulatory and compliance matters including:

  • Scoping perimeter and Part 4A permissions advice.
  • Advising on application for authorisations (but not necessarily completing applications) and change in control approvals (including change in control applications).
  • Product and services design including evaluating how innovative and novel FinTech products fit into the regulatory framework.
  • Advice on all aspects of the FCA Handbook and PRA Rule Book MiFID AIFMD MCD CRR (etc).
  • Advice on cross border aspects of financial services regulation.
  • Corporate governance of authorised firms.
  • Payment services and open banking.
  • Advising and drafting documents such as terms and conditions for regulated activities.
  • Advising on remediation self-reporting and engagement with the regulators.
  • Assisting the corporate team on FSMA aspects of M&A.
  • Assisting other teams across the firm (dispute resolution commercial private wealth family housing etc) on FSMA related matters (in particular regulated credit and regulated mortgages).
  • Monitoring changes in financial services regulations and update clients accordingly.
  • Promoting the firms financial services regulation capabilities by speaking at seminars writing articles etc.
  • Providing internal training

Essential & Desirable Criteria

Qualified solicitor with ideally least four years experience specialising in financial services law and regulation (UK).

This is a legal (and not compliance) position.

The ability to exercise sound judgment imagination and creativity in a fast-moving sector.

Strong analytical skills and precise attention to detail will be key attributes of a successful applicant

Excellent communication abilities. Ability to work with clients from various international backgrounds who are often unfamiliar with the UK financial services sector and environment.

Ability to work both independently and collaboratively across teams throughout the firm and promote the firms financial services regulation capabilities internally as well as externally.
